Uber offers many different payment methods to pay for your ride or Uber Eats order, and there are several easy ways to add and switch between payment options.
You can even change your payment method after a ride is over!
Read on to see how to add different payment options, and how to use Uber Cash, and what to do if you run into problems.
Uber & Uber Eats accept these payment methods
- Credit and debit cards
- Bank account with Link
- Paypal
- Venmo
- Apple Pay
- Google Pay
- Klarna
- Gift card
- Uber Cash
- CVS Pharmacy
- S3 Health Benefits Card
Zelle is not currently a payment option on Uber.
Uber does not accept cash (in the United States)
You can’t pay for an Uber ride in cash in the US, but you can tip your driver with cash. Cash on delivery (COD) is also not available for Uber Eats deliveries.
You must have an active payment method in your Uber Wallet to request a ride, and it will automatically be charged after the ride is complete.
Uber has an in-app credit system called Uber Cash, but it is not the same as paying in cash.
Plenty of ways to pay
Related: How much does Uber cost? Uber fare estimator
How to add a payment method to your Uber account
You can add a payment method to your Uber Wallet in your account settings, or you can add a payment method when you request a ride or place an Uber Eats order.
To add a payment option to your Uber Wallet, tap Account in the lower right corner of the home screen, then tap Wallet.
Scroll to ‘Add payment method‘ and select the Payment Method you want to add. Follow the on-screen instructions to add your payment method.
Go to Account > Wallet to add a payment option
To add a payment method when you request a ride: Enter your destination, then tap on the payment method icon near the bottom of the screen. You can change the payment method, or add a new one.
How to select a different credit card or payment option
You can select a payment method before you request an Uber, and you can change you payment method during a trip.
To change your payment method before you request a ride:
- Enter your destination
- Tap the credit card icon at the bottom of the screen
- Select a different payment option or enter a new one

How to use a bank account to pay for Uber
Through a partnership with Link, you can now directly link your bank account with your Uber profile to pay for rides and deliveries. In your Wallet, tap Add payment method and find the Bank account option.
After you follow steps to link your bank account, you will be able to pay for Uber directly from your bank account.
Pay with Apple Pay or Google Pay
You can pay for Uber and Uber Eats with Apple Pay and Google Pay.
If Apple Pay or Google Pay are already set up on your phone, go to your Wallet to enable it as a payment method.
In your Wallet, tap Apple Pay or Google Pay to link to your Uber account. After that, you’ll be able to select Apply Pay or Google Pay from your list of payment methods.
How to change the payment method for a past trip
If you used the wrong payment method for a past trip, it is possible to change the payment method if the trip is less than 30 days old.
Go to Activity at the bottom of the Uber app and find the trip. Tap Receipt, then scroll to find ‘Switch payment method.‘ Select your preferred payment type.
You can follow the same steps at help.uber.com or in the email receipt that you receive for each trip.
Go to the ride receipt to change the payment method for a past trip
What is Uber Cash?
Uber Cash is Uber credits that you can use to pay for rides or Uber Eats orders. You can purchase Uber Cash in the Uber app, or you can be rewarded Uber cash from special promotions or refunds.
Gift card balances appear as Uber Cash, credits offered by Uber support appear as Uber Cash, and some other promotional credits also appear as Uber Cash.
To use Uber Cash to pay for a ride, select it as a payment method before you request the ride or place an order.
How to get Uber Cash
- Purchase it: Buy Uber Cash inside the app
- Earn it as a credit card reward: Some credit cards (such as the Amex Platinum Card) offer Uber Cash as a reward

Load your account with Uber Cash to get a small discount
Uber promo codes: Another way to get Uber discounts
Uber offers promo codes for new users that give a discount on rides. To add a promo code, head to Account > Wallet, then scroll to “Add Promo Code.” Enter the code there.
My code: Use promo code cws7s2 to get a discount. It works for all new users in the USA.
Promotions from Uber promo codes are automatically applied to rides. You can’t prevent a promo code promotion from applying to a ride. Promo codes are applied in reverse order, meaning your most recently added code will be applied to your next trip.
What to do if you can’t add a credit card to your Uber account
Some users follow steps to add a new payment method only to find that the card doesn’t become available in the list of payment options.
If that happens, restart the app and repeat the process. If that doesn’t work, you will need to contact Uber customer service.
How to delete a credit card or payment option from your account
To delete a credit card or other payment method, tap Account > Wallet.
Tap the payment method you want to delete, then tap Remove payment method.
What to do when you can’t delete a payment method
When you get a new credit card, you might want to delete an old one before you add the new one.
You may see this error message: “You must have at least one payment method active.” To prevent that error, add in your new card first before you delete the old one. It may take a day or two for the old card to disappear.
You can update a credit card expiration date without deleting and re adding the card. Go to Payment, select the card, then tap the icon in the upper right to edit the card info.
Another problem Uber users run into is when a deleted payment method still show up as a payment option. You can ignore the old card, but make sure to select your current card when you request a ride to prevent errors.
If fully deleting the card from your account is important to you and you’re unable to do it yourself, contact Uber.
Can more than one Uber account use the same credit card?
Uber may not allow you to add or select a credit card that is already in use by another account. Some users see this error message, “This payment method is being shared by too many uber accounts.”
Uber examines credit card and phone number usage to prevent fraud. If a credit card is connected to too many accounts, it can trigger fraud detection systems.
If you’re sharing the credit card with a family member, consider creating a Family Profile to ensure that you can share the card.
More Uber Tips
David S says
If you come from UK the zip code box does not allow UK post codes. I just entered a random set of numbers until the ‘Add payment’ turned from grey to black. It then all worked OK.
Judy Krame says
I have to change my credit card because the American Express Costco card is no longer valid. I need help to change my credit card. I tried online to change but it doesn’t let you when clicking edit. I went on the phone app and I don’t see a place to change it. Why is it so difficult.
DougH says
It should be easier. Don’t think of it as ‘changing’ your card, think of it as adding a new card. Instead of trying to remove the old one, just add your new one. That seems to be easier in the app.
Keith says
Also, if you’re UK, don’t put in postcode where it says Zip, just add 5 random numbers till the box changes to black, then click.
Thanmaya says
My credit card expired and the company issued me a new one, with the same number but updated expiry and CVV number. I tried to add this to the Uber app, it said a card with the same number already exists. Then I tried to edit the existing expired one, doesn’t allow me to on the app. On the web portal, it allowed me to edit, but when saved, the updated details did not save!
It doesn’t let me delete the expired card, as it needs at least one payment method!
So eventually, I added my debit card. Deleted my expired card, added the new card. Then I deleted the debit card!
DougH says
I went through a similar frustrating loop — trying to delete my one expired card and being told I need one payment method. It’s pretty silly, but you figured out the way around it.
Jenny Crocker says
My credit card expired and I need to update IT. When I follow these instructions I don’t get a ‘change’ option. I just get the last four digits of my old credit card and the rest of the panel is blank. Very frustrating. Is there someone who can help?
DougH says
I added a section about this. In short, add the new card and delete the old one. If the old one doesn’t go away, don’t worry about it.
DonM says
How do I delete a credit card from Uber?
DougH says
Head to the Payment area of the app. Tap the card you want to delete, then tap the pencil icon in the upper-right corner. That will bring up a delete button.
salaadin says
Please help me with UBER
I have Microsoft Lumia 535
And i have installed uber on it
When i sign-up only credit card. And visa option appears. Not the. Cash option
So what do i Do ?
DougH says
I’m not familiar with any cash payment options. You can pay with Visa, MasterCard, Paypal, Google Wallet.
Syed says
When I am trying to add my Amex card plus the paypal setup i have already inplaced so its asking me for ZIP.
does anyone knows about it what it is really?
DougH says
I’m not sure I understand your question.